NetBSD-Bugs arch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

Re: kern/38246: another simple_lock deadlock in netbsd-4, possibly scheduler related (sa_switch(2073.2): no upcall data.)



The following reply was made to PR kern/38246; it has been noted by GNATS.

From: "Greg A. Woods; Planix, Inc." <woods%planix.ca@localhost>
To: yamt%mwd.biglobe.ne.jp@localhost (YAMAMOTO Takashi)
Cc: gnats-bugs%NetBSD.org@localhost,
 kern-bug-people%netbsd.org@localhost
Subject: Re: kern/38246: another simple_lock deadlock in netbsd-4, possibly 
scheduler related (sa_switch(2073.2): no upcall data.)
Date: Mon, 17 Mar 2008 12:01:49 -0400

 On 16-Mar-08, at 6:59 PM, YAMAMOTO Takashi wrote:
 
 >> [Sun Mar 16 11:39:33 2008]db{0}> trace
 >> [Sun Mar 16 11:39:36 2008]cpu_Debugger 
 >> (d95456f4,1,ffff,c095b5c7,c041cfe0) at netbsd:cpu_Debugger+0x4
 >> [Sun Mar 16 11:39:36 2008]_simple_lock_assert_unlocked 
 >> (c09de194,c093178f,c0989310,2fc,596) at  
 >> netbsd:_simple_lock_assert_unlocked+0x135
 >> [Sun Mar 16 11:39:36 2008]wakeup(c5e9ce6c,c09875cc,4eb,d9545780,0)  
 >> at netbsd:wakeup+0x32
 >> [Sun Mar 16 11:39:36 2008]knote_enqueue 
 >> (c5e9de58,0,d95457cc,c03c87d9,c) at netbsd:knote_enqueue+0x1ae
 >> [Sun Mar 16 11:39:36 2008]knote(c0a6dfd0,0,32373032,c,d9668018) at  
 >> netbsd:knote+0x42
 >> [Sun Mar 16 11:39:36 2008]logwakeup(c0988f88,5,0,0,d95457d0) at  
 >> netbsd:logwakeup+0x34
 >> [Sun Mar 16 11:39:36 2008]printf(c0988f88,819,2,3a7,c0a564d0) at  
 >> netbsd:printf+0xc5
 >> [Sun Mar 16 11:39:36 2008]sa_switch(d93f6208,0,2,238,d967aa84) at  
 >> netbsd:sa_switch+0x3eb
 >
 > see PR/20536.
 
 Hmmmm....  "suspended"????  and without any hint as to what the fix  
 is, yet it continues on through three more major releases!
 
 -- 
                                        Greg A. Woods; Planix, Inc.
                                        <woods%planix.ca@localhost>
 
 
 


Home | Main Index | Thread Index | Old Index